Output 59275d20b934a3b34d6cbab0771abcfdf15391479c7f84cb40fa3688935591c8: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c196317d68d07797ce218bb6298155821215b622 OP_EQUAL
address
3KLcGBVx75d3v1mH53HZh5qBRtAMqKTdzz
transaction
59275d20b934a3b34d6cbab0771abcfdf15391479c7f84cb40fa3688935591c8
confirmations
170603
spent
true